Remove the done and error callbacks. The error callback is in an error message. The done callback is replace with spa_pending. Make enum_params take a callback and data for the results. This allows us to push the results one after another to the app and avoids ownership issues of the passed data. We can then extend this to handle the async case by doing a _wait call with a spa_pending+callback+data that will be called when the _enum_params returns and async result. Add a sync method. All methods can now return SPA_RESULT_IS_ASYNC return values and you can use spa_node_wait() to register a callback when they complete with optional extra parameters. This makes it easier to sync and handle the reply. Make helper methods to simulate the sync enum_params behaviour for sync nodes. Let the transport generate the sequence number for pw_resource_sync() and pw_proxy_sync(). That way we don't need to keep track of numbers ourselves and we can match the reply to the request easily.
